Housekeeping items are the least popular of all tasks in any
|
|
organisation, and any organisation that is working under pressure has
|
|
a tendency of accumulating them.
|
|
That is why after the intensive work of the past year to build up and
|
|
grow the Freedom Task Force, work on antitrust and OOXML issues, and
|
|
various other activities, FSFE had some of them as well.
|
|
Fortunately, after substantial preparation and three intensive days,
|
|
FSFE's General Assembly in June managed to take care of them and send
|
|
everyone home highly motivated and with a full task list. The results
|
|
of this will become slowly visible throughout the coming year.
